Safety Considerations for Lap Dogs
Large breeds might control play with their power and size, but lap dogs require particular focus to ensure their security in daycare setups.
When you select a day care, make sure the facility has different play areas for small breeds, lessening the risk of accidental injuries. Ensure staff members are trained to monitor interactions very closely and can identify indicators of stress or discomfort in lap dogs.
Additionally, inspect that the setting is without threats like sharp objects or huge barriers that can position a hazard.
It's additionally essential to verify that all pets in the team work in dimension and personality.
Safety And Security Factors To Consider for Large Pet Dogs
When choosing a daycare for your large pet dog, it's vital to prioritize their security in a setting that fits their dimension and energy.
Seek facilities with roomy backyard that stop overcrowding and allow your pet dog to move easily. Make certain that employee are educated to manage big types, as they might need various handling compared to smaller sized canines.
Inspect if the daycare has protected fence and safe play devices designed for larger dogs. Observe just how they divide dogs based on dimension and personality; this minimizes the threat of mishaps.
Lastly, think about the daycare's emergency situation protocols and ensure they have actually the required devices and training to take care of any kind of situation that might develop. Your dog's safety ought to always come first.

Choosing the Right daycare Facility
Finding the right day care facility for your dog can make all the distinction in their happiness and well-being.
Begin by visiting potential facilities to observe their setting and team communications. Try to find tidiness, safety measures, and adequate room for play. Examine if they divide small breeds from huge ones to make sure safety and comfort.
Inquire about their staff-to-dog ratio; fewer canines per caretaker suggests extra listening. Don't fail to remember to inquire about daily tasks and socializing possibilities. A good facility must additionally have clear policies on wellness testings and emergency situation protocols.
Lastly, count on your impulses-- if a location doesn't feel right, maintain searching. Your canine deserves a nurturing and engaging setting tailored to their requirements.
